(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["yb_wm-shop-reserve-yyxq"],{"085a":function(t,e,a){"use strict";var s;a.d(e,"b",(function(){return i})),a.d(e,"c",(function(){return r})),a.d(e,"a",(function(){return s}));var i=function(){var t=this,e=t.$createElement,a=t._self._c||e;return t.co.state?a("v-uni-view",{staticClass:"bf9 mvh100 pb130"},[a("v-uni-view",{staticClass:"yyxqbgc p-r cf",style:{background:"linear-gradient(90deg,"+t.tbgo+","+t.tColor+")"}},[a("v-uni-view",{staticClass:"top"},[a("v-uni-view",{staticClass:"f44 wei"},[t._v(t._s(t.co.s1))]),a("v-uni-view",{staticClass:"mt10"},[t._v(t._s(t.co.s2))]),2==t.co.state?a("v-uni-view",{staticClass:"mt20"},[a("v-uni-view",{staticClass:"bztc p-r f-y-c"},[a("v-uni-view",{staticClass:"bzyd",class:{active:0==t.aIdx},style:{background:t.tbgo2}}),a("v-uni-view",{staticClass:"bzhx f-1",style:{background:t.tbgo2}}),a("v-uni-view",{staticClass:"bzyd",class:{active:1==t.aIdx},style:{background:t.tbgo2}}),a("v-uni-view",{staticClass:"bzhx f-1",style:{background:t.tbgo2}}),a("v-uni-view",{staticClass:"bzyd",class:{active:2==t.aIdx},style:{background:t.tbgo2}}),a("v-uni-view",{staticClass:"p-a jdt",style:{width:(t.aIdx+1)/3*100+"%"}})],1),a("v-uni-view",{staticClass:"f-x-bt mt10"},t._l(t.arr,(function(e,s){return a("v-uni-view",{key:s,style:{opacity:s==t.aIdx?"":"0.6"}},[t._v(t._s(e))])})),1)],1):t._e()],1),a("v-uni-view",{staticClass:"p-a b0 zjsjx"})],1),a("v-uni-view",{staticClass:"p3 p-r",style:{marginTop:"-230rpx"}},[3==t.co.state&&t.zqmArr?a("v-uni-view",{staticClass:"bf p23 bs20 b-s mb30"},[a("v-uni-view",{staticClass:"f30 wei"},[t._v("订单核销码")]),a("v-uni-view",{staticClass:"mt30 mb20 f-c"},t._l(t.zqmArr,(function(e,s){return a("v-uni-view",{key:s,staticClass:"zqmc f-c",class:{mr30:s0?a("v-uni-view",{staticClass:"p20 f-row"},[a("v-uni-view",{staticClass:"f32 mr30 c3"},[t._v("预约定金")]),a("v-uni-view",{staticClass:"f-1"},[t._v(t._s(t.co.money))])],1):t._e(),a("v-uni-view",{staticClass:"p20 f-row"},[a("v-uni-view",{staticClass:"f32 mr30 c3"},[t._v("下单时间")]),a("v-uni-view",{staticClass:"f-1"},[t._v(t._s(t.timeToDate(t.co.createdAt)))])],1),a("v-uni-view",{staticClass:"p20 f-row"},[a("v-uni-view",{staticClass:"f32 mr30 c3"},[t._v("订单编号")]),a("v-uni-view",{staticClass:"f-1"},[t._v(t._s(t.co.outTradeNo))])],1),t.co.note?a("v-uni-view",{staticClass:"p20 f-row"},[a("v-uni-view",{staticClass:"f32 mr30 c3"},[t._v("订单备注")]),a("v-uni-view",{staticClass:"f-1"},[t._v(t._s(t.co.note))])],1):t._e()],1),4==t.co.state||6==t.co.state?a("v-uni-text",{staticClass:"p-a iconfont yyzt",class:4==t.co.state?"iconyjj":"iconyqx"}):t._e()],1)],1),a("v-uni-view",{staticClass:"foot-btnc"},[2==t.co.state||3==t.co.state||4==t.co.state||6==t.co.state?a("v-uni-button",{staticClass:"foot-btn",style:{background:t.co.state<4?"#ddd":"linear-gradient(90deg,"+t.tbgo+","+t.tColor+")"},attrs:{loading:t.loading,disabled:t.loading,"hover-class":"btnhc"},on:{click:function(e){arguments[0]=e=t.$handleEvent(e),t.save.apply(void 0,arguments)}}},[t._v(t._s(2==t.co.state||3==t.co.state?"取消订单":"重新预约"))]):t._e()],1)],1):t._e()},r=[]},1932:function(t,e,a){"use strict";var s=a("470b"),i=a.n(s);i.a},"299e":function(t,e,a){"use strict";a.r(e);var s=a("2ad5"),i=a.n(s);for(var r in s)"default"!==r&&function(t){a.d(e,t,(function(){return s[t]}))}(r);e["default"]=i.a},"2ad5":function(t,e,a){"use strict";var s=a("4ea4");a("ac1f"),a("1276"),Object.defineProperty(e,"__esModule",{value:!0}),e.default=void 0,a("96cf");var i=s(a("1da1")),r=(a("2f62"),a("4789")),n=s(a("8bb1")),c={name:"reserve-yyxq",data:function(){return{aIdx:0,arr:["联系商家中","商家处理中","结果确认"],loading:!1,co:{}}},onLoad:function(t){this.query=t,this.getSystem({nosetNB:1}),this.util.setNT("预约详情"),this.getData()},mixins:[r.utilMixins],computed:{tbgo:function(){return"rgba(".concat(this.cTR(this.tColor),",0.65)")},tbgo2:function(){return this.cTRld(this.tColor,.15)},zqmArr:function(){return this.co.code&&this.co.code.split("")}},methods:{getData:function(){var t=this;return(0,i.default)(regeneratorRuntime.mark((function e(){var a,s,i,r;return regeneratorRuntime.wrap((function(e){while(1)switch(e.prev=e.next){case 0:return e.next=2,t.util.request({url:t.api.yyxq,mask:1,data:{id:t.query.id}});case 2:a=e.sent,s=a.data,e.t0=+s.state,e.next=1===e.t0?7:2===e.t0?10:3===e.t0?13:4===e.t0?16:5===e.t0?19:6===e.t0?22:25;break;case 7:return i="订单待支付",r="请尽快支付",e.abrupt("break",25);case 10:return i="订单待确认",r="等待商家确认中,稍后将以短信方式告知结果",e.abrupt("break",25);case 13:return i="待到店",r="商家已确认您的预定信息,请您按时到店就餐",e.abrupt("break",25);case 16:return i="订单已拒绝",r="拒绝理由:商家暂时无法接受预定",e.abrupt("break",25);case 19:return i="订单已核销",r="期待下次光临",e.abrupt("break",25);case 22:return i="订单已取消",r="取消理由:行程有变需重新下单",e.abrupt("break",25);case 25:s.s1=i,s.s2=r,t.co=s;case 28:case"end":return e.stop()}}),e)})))()},qxdd:function(t){var e=this;return(0,i.default)(regeneratorRuntime.mark((function a(){var s;return regeneratorRuntime.wrap((function(a){while(1)switch(a.prev=a.next){case 0:if(!t){a.next=9;break}return a.prev=1,a.next=4,e.util.modal("您确认取消订单吗?");case 4:a.next=9;break;case 6:return a.prev=6,a.t0=a["catch"](1),a.abrupt("return");case 9:return a.next=11,e.util.request({url:e.api.qxyy,method:"POST",mask:"取消订单中",data:{id:e.query.id,type:"cancel"}});case 11:s=a.sent,s&&(e.util.message("操作成功",1),n.default.swnb(1e3));case 13:case"end":return a.stop()}}),a,null,[[1,6]])})))()},save:function(){2==this.co.state||3==this.co.state?this.qxdd(1):this.go({t:3,url:"/yb_wm/index/index?storeId=".concat(this.co.storeId)})}}};e.default=c},"470b":function(t,e,a){var s=a("5e27");"string"===typeof s&&(s=[[t.i,s,""]]),s.locals&&(t.exports=s.locals);var i=a("4f06").default;i("7baec2f6",s,!0,{sourceMap:!1,shadowMode:!1})},4789:function(t,e,a){"use strict";var s=a("4ea4");a("c975"),a("a9e3"),a("b680"),Object.defineProperty(e,"__esModule",{value:!0}),e.utilMixins=e.sljz=void 0;var i=s(a("5530")),r=a("2f62"),n=s(a("8bb1")),c={data:function(){return{dataList:[],bfList:[],isget:!1,mygd:!1}},onReachBottom:n.default.debounce((function(t){!this.mygd&&this.isget&&(this.isget=!1,this.getList())}),300)};e.sljz=c;var o={computed:(0,i.default)({},(0,r.mapState)({})),methods:{timeToDate:function(t,e){return n.default.timeToDate(t,e)},dateToTime:function(t){return n.default.dateToTime(t)},getSingleImg:function(t){return t.indexOf("http")>-1?t:this.url+t},snText:function(t,e){return t&&t.length>e?t.substring(0,e)+"...":t},blxs:function(t){var e=arguments.length>1&&void 0!==arguments[1]?arguments[1]:2;return Number(Number(t).toFixed(e))},payName:function(t){var e="";switch(+t){case 1:e="微信支付";break;case 2:e="支付宝支付";break;case 3:e="百度支付";break;case 5:e="余额支付";break}return e},cTR:function(t){return n.default.colorToRGB(t)},cTRld:function(t,e){return n.default.ldColor(t,e)}}};e.utilMixins=o},"54ad":function(t,e,a){"use strict";a.r(e);var s=a("085a"),i=a("299e");for(var r in i)"default"!==r&&function(t){a.d(e,t,(function(){return i[t]}))}(r);a("1932");var n,c=a("f0c5"),o=Object(c["a"])(i["default"],s["b"],s["c"],!1,null,"23811b64",null,!1,s["a"],n);e["default"]=o.exports},"5e27":function(t,e,a){var s=a("24fb");e=s(!1),e.push([t.i,'.yyxqbgc[data-v-23811b64]{padding-bottom:%?200?%}.yyxqbgc .top[data-v-23811b64]{padding:%?30?% %?50?%}.bztc[data-v-23811b64]{padding:%?10?% %?0?%;margin:0 %?50?%}.bztc .jdt[data-v-23811b64]{top:50%;left:0;-webkit-transform:translateY(-50%);transform:translateY(-50%);height:%?6?%;background:#fff}.bzyd[data-v-23811b64]{width:%?18?%;height:%?18?%;-webkit-border-radius:50%;border-radius:50%}.active[data-v-23811b64]{position:relative}.active[data-v-23811b64]::after{content:"";position:absolute;width:%?35?%;height:%?35?%;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);background:hsla(0,0%,100%,.4);-webkit-border-radius:50%;border-radius:50%}.active[data-v-23811b64]::before{content:"";position:absolute;width:%?18?%;height:%?18?%;top:50%;left: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);background:#fff;-webkit-border-radius:50%;border-radius:50%}.bzhx[data-v-23811b64]{height:%?6?%}.zjsjx[data-v-23811b64]{width:0;height:0;border-color:#f9f9f9 transparent;border-width:0 0 %?130?% 100vw;border-style:solid}.yyzt[data-v-23811b64]{top:%?110?%;right:%?50?%;font-size:%?160?%;color:#ddd}.zqmc[data-v-23811b64]{width:%?80?%;height:%?80?%;-webkit-border-radius:%?10?%;border-radius:%?10?%;border:1px dashed #ddd}',""]),t.exports=e}}]);